This position analyzes user requirements, concept of operations documents, and high-level system architectures to develop system requirements specifications. The role involves analyzing system requirements and leading design and development activities, guiding users in formulating requirements, advising on alternative approaches, and conducting feasibility studies. The System Engineer 2 provides technical leadership for the integration of requirements, design, and technology, and incorporates new plans, designs, and systems into ongoing operations. This role also involves developing technical documentation and system architecture/design documentation. The position guides system development and implementation planning through assessment or preparation of system engineering management plans and system integration and test plans. The engineer will interact with the Government regarding Systems Engineering technical considerations and associated problems, issues, or conflicts, holding ultimate responsibility for the technical integrity of work performed and deliverables within the Systems Engineering area. Communication with other program personnel, government overseers, and senior executives is also a key aspect of this role.
